Detroit City Council Renews ShotSpotter Contract

The Detroit City Council has narrowly voted to renew its contract for the ShotSpotter gunshot detection system. The decision comes despite opposition from some community members and council members. The renewal includes a financial allocation of $2 million.

What Happened

The Detroit City Council voted to renew the contract for the ShotSpotter gunshot detection system. The vote was narrow, indicating division among council members regarding the technology's continued use. The renewal of the contract is associated with a $2 million allocation.

While the articles do not detail the specific reasons for opposition, the vote's narrow margin suggests that concerns were raised during the council's deliberations. The Detroit Free Press headline highlights the financial aspect of the renewal, noting the $2 million figure.

ShotSpotter is a technology used to detect and locate gunfire in urban areas. The renewal of its contract in Detroit signifies a continued investment in this type of public safety technology.
